Measure the strip at mid-thickness
Metal bent into a ring stretches on the outside and compresses on the inside. Halfway between, the neutral axis does neither — and that circle is the one whose circumference equals the flat strip you started with. So the blank is the inside diameter plus one whole thickness: not two, and certainly not zero.
| Stock, for a 17 mm ring | Blank to cut | Inside circumference | Short by | Would finish at |
|---|---|---|---|---|
| 0.5 mm | 54.98 mm | 53.41 mm | 1.57 mm | 16.50 mm |
| 1 mm | 56.55 mm | 53.41 mm | 3.14 mm | 16.00 mm |
| 1.5 mm | 58.12 mm | 53.41 mm | 4.71 mm | 15.50 mm |
| 2 mm | 59.69 mm | 53.41 mm | 6.28 mm | 15.00 mm |
| 3 mm | 62.83 mm | 53.41 mm | 9.42 mm | 14.00 mm |
Cutting to the inside circumference is the natural mistake, and it comes out short by exactly π times the thickness. On 3 mm stock that is 9.42 mm of strip, and the ring closes at 14 mm instead of 17 — a loss of exactly one thickness of diameter, which is several sizes.
The error does not depend on the ring size
π times the thickness, whatever the diameter — so it is proportionally worst on small rings
in heavy stock. A 0.5 mm band comes out only
0.5 mm under and you might not notice; a 3 mm one
is out by 3 mm and unwearable. The same cut list cannot be right
for both, and the blanks differ by
7.9 mm for the identical finished
size.
Each extra millimetre of thickness adds exactly π millimetres to the blank, which is a
pleasant thing to be able to do in your head: about 3.14 mm of strip per millimetre of stock,
regardless of what size ring you are making.

Frequently asked questions
How long should a ring blank be?
Pi times the inside diameter PLUS one thickness. Metal bent into a ring stretches on the outside and compresses on the inside; halfway between, the neutral axis does neither, and that circle is the one whose circumference equals the flat strip you started with.
What if I cut to the inside circumference?
The ring comes out short by exactly pi times the thickness, and closes one whole thickness under the diameter you wanted. On 3 mm stock a 17 mm ring finishes at 14 mm — several sizes, and unwearable.
Or the outside circumference?
Too long, by exactly as much as the inside is too short. The blank sits precisely halfway between the two, which is a useful check on any figure you are given.
Does the error depend on the ring size?
No — it is pi times the thickness whatever the diameter. That makes it proportionally worst on small rings in heavy stock: a 0.5 mm band is half a millimetre under and you might not notice, while a 3 mm one is out by three.
How much extra per millimetre of thickness?
Exactly pi, about 3.14 mm of strip per millimetre of stock, regardless of ring size. That is a pleasant thing to be able to do in your head when adjusting a cut list.
Why does the tool not do ring size conversion?
Because size charts vary between countries and between makers, and the conversion is not what the calculation depends on. Measure a mandrel or a ring that fits, and enter the diameter — that removes a source of error rather than adding one.
Should I add anything for the saw?
Yes — the kerf, plus whatever you take off truing the ends for the joint. A blank a whisker long can be filed down; one a whisker short is scrap.
